    The government building by the Danube, and the ruin bars. Reagan statue, shoes along the Danube, and communist history tour if that interests you.
    I also went to the Communist Statue Museum, which is a little outside Budapest, but it was pretty cool for 30 mins. It was literally just looking at the statues and then leaving. No real "museum" stuff.

    There's a place in Prague called Naše Maso and I think I had the best steak of my life there.

    It's a butchers with a couple of tables in it. You go up to the counter and point at what you want and they fry it up in the back.

    St. John in London is the same idea and is one of the best restaurants in the country. They're on to something.
